The traditional password advice built around 'password complexity' failed because it told us to do things that most of us simply can't do (i.e. memorise lots of long, complex passwords).
Passwords generated from three random words help users to create unique passwords that are strong enough for many purposes, and can be remembered much more easily. This is also good for those who aren't aware of password managers, or are reluctant to use them. However, there are several other reasons why the NCSC chose the three random words strategy.
Length
Passwords made from multiple words will generally be longer than passwords made from a single word. Length is a common (and recommended) requirement for passwords, and promoting the use of a 'passphrase' created by combining words provides a way to achieve this without relying on predictable patterns (such as the addition of ! at the end of a password).
Impact
To have a meaningful impact, the NCSC needed to be able to promote a technique across different media, in a way that could be quickly understood in most contexts. 'Three random words' contains all the essential information in the title, and can be quickly explained, even to those who don't consider themselves computer experts.
Novelty
The stereotypical password is a single dictionary word or name, with predictable character replacements. By recommending multiple words we immediately challenge that perception, and encourage a range of passwords that have not previously been considered.
Usability
The main issue with enforcing complexity requirements is that it's difficult for users to generate, remember, and enter complex passwords correctly without substantial effort, which further encourages the re-use of passwords. Three random words' power is in its usability, because security that's not usable doesn't work.

Method 2: Download Password Generator extension for Chrome and install in Developer Mode
This is another method to install Password Generator extension manually, but the twist is that here, you install by enabling the developer mode option provided in Google Chrome. This mode is commonly used for testing extensions or running unpublished tools.
Step 1: Download the Password Generator extension file
Select and download the Password Generator extension by clicking the 'Download CRX' button on the website.
Step 2: Extract the downloaded contents
Convert the file to a ZIP file if it is in CRX format then extract the Password Generator extension zip file or folder that you downloaded. Make sure you extract it using the same folder name and keep it safely in another folder, so you don't delete it by mistake. The extracted folder will be needed to keep your Password Generator extension running.
Step 3: Open Chrome Extension Setting Page
In the address bar of Google Chrome, type chrome://extensions and open the Chrome Extension Page.
Step 4: Enable Developer Mode
After opening the Chrome Extension page, look at the top right side, and you will find the toggle option of "Developer mode."Simply enable that developer mode option.
Step 5: Load the Unpacked Extension
Once you enable the developer mode option, you will see the menu of Load Unpacked, Pack Extensions and Update. From that, select the option "Load unpacked."
Step 6: Select the Extension Folder
Once the pop-up opens upon clicking Load unpacked, select the Password Generator extension directory and click on the "Select Folder "button.
Step 7: Confirm and Install
After you select an extension folder of a Google Chrome extension you're installing manually, confirm its installation for the final time and let the installation complete.
